Transaction 2c8e29bbed24536be4b48055896ff595950bf8cfa6f4b188f00ac698ad708d83
1 Input
2 Outputs
- 2c8e29bbed24536be4b48055896ff595950bf8cfa6f4b188f00ac698ad708d83:0
- 2c8e29bbed24536be4b48055896ff595950bf8cfa6f4b188f00ac698ad708d83:1
value 13230275
address 1DuEzk6bwDL8EgMf522iPDVy2z98dV7kQQ
value 866375175
address 1M4tC5GNdNrgcofDAr3V2vMm94tc72Pp72